    We stopped here for our breakfast/lunch and it was so good! We're on a road trip right now and so far this is my favorite place we've stopped. My mom and I shared the green which was a delicious sandwich with hummus and super greens. We got it on sour dough bread and we aren't "healthy" people but it's so honestly one of my new favorite sandwiches! We also got the fresh squeezed orange juice which we literally watched the employee squeeze, it was so good. My brother got the Eleven with an herb bagel and he really enjoyed it even though it wasn't something he would normally have. His girlfriend got a bagel which she said was really good! The employees were both very nice (and dressed really cutely). And the shop was adorable with a little chalk board wall that you could draw on and a nook where you could eat. We ended up sitting outside and eating it was a really good experience!

    I came here with my dad to work on some emails. The environment was perfect for finishing up some work. It was cozy and they have free WiFi available, which was very fast and reliable. Our coffee was so good! My dad got an Americano, he's pretty picky about his coffee, milk and water ratio and was delighted with how it was made here. He actually called his brother right after the first few sips and told him he had to come by and try a cup! I got the Honey Lavender Oat special. It was super tasty! I'm dairy free and was impressed with the amount of dairy free and vegan options. We didn't try any of the sandwiches this time but we plan on coming back. We did have some muffins, they were soft and tasted fresh. Staff was kind and friendly. They have reusable dishes and silverware and take contactless payments. There's some seating options both inside and outside. Parking is street parking as it's in a residential neighborhood.

    Came here to meet with a friend/colleague. The cold brew is delicious and $5 for 16oz and there are a good selection of sandwiches. No meat but there are eggs. I ordered the Rozz on a herb and salt bagel and it was so delicious. The cheese was melts and the pesto was perfect for a brunch snack. Service was cool too, there are 3 sitting areas outside and 3 inside. Good place to work from if you need to get out of the house. Also off the Main Street so it's pretty quiet. Not quiet enough for a phone call but quiet enough to work.

    Super cute neighborhood cafe. They've got plenty of vegan/vegetarian options to choose from, and delicious Trailhead coffee. They've also got ample seating inside and out,perfect for relaxing or studying. The folks at the counter were sweet and helpful, and definitely know how to make a delicious creamy latte. The vegan bagel sandwiches (+eggs) were so filling and packed full of veggies. The perfect breakfast fuel for a morning on Mt Hood. Definitely give this sweet spot a try!
